PEaCE: A Chemistry-Oriented Dataset for Optical Character Recognition on Scientific Documents
March 26, 2024, 4:50 a.m. | Nan Zhang, Connor Heaton, Sean Timothy Okonsky, Prasenjit Mitra, Hilal Ezgi Toraman
cs.CL updates on arXiv.org arxiv.org
Abstract: Optical Character Recognition (OCR) is an established task with the objective of identifying the text present in an image. While many off-the-shelf OCR models exist, they are often trained for either scientific (e.g., formulae) or generic printed English text. Extracting text from chemistry publications requires an OCR model that is capable in both realms.
